The proxy caches the request in this case, so it prevents duplicate requests from hitting catbox, forming an 'origin shield' of sorts, where the origin is catbox.

[ - ] chrimony 4 points 7 monthsSep 12, 2023 15:39:37 ago (+4/-0)

Yes, but it also funnels requests in from one IP address for the first hit. It looks like an unusual bunch of traffic coming from one IP. So does the site admin know that this is supposed to reduce traffic?

And let's say he knows: as a site owner, would you want all your users to get in the habit of visiting somebody else's front end site instead, for which you are just the backend? Then this other site starts hosting images, and catbox becomes an afterthought.
